Background
Leukocyte-derived arginine aminopeptidase (LRAP), also known as endoplasmic reticulum-aminopeptidase 2 (ERAP2), is the second identified aminopeptidase localized in the in the lumenal side of endoplasmic reticulum (ER) processing antigenic peptides presented to major histocompatibility complex (MHC) class I molecules. It is a 960-amino acid protein with significant homology to placental leucine aminopeptidase and adipocyte-derived leucine aminopeptidase. LRAP preferentially hydrolyzes the basic residues Arg and Lys, and contains the HEXXH (X) 18E zinc-binding motif, which is the characteristic of the M1 family of zinc metallopeptidases which also includes PILS/ARTS1/ERAP1 and LNPEP/PLAP. Induced by interferon-gamma, LRAP is able to trim various MHC class I antigenic peptide precursors.
